The production of η′ mesons in the reactions pp→ppη′ and pn→pnη′ at threshold-near energies is analyzed within a covariant effective
meson-nucleon theory. The description of cross section and angular
distributions of the available data in this kinematical region in the pp
channel is accomplished by including meson currents and nucleon currents with
the resonances S11(1650), P11(1710) and P13(1720). Predictions
for the pn channel are given. The di-electron production from subsequent
η′ Dalitz decay η′→γγ∗→γe+e− is also
calculated and numerical results are presented for intermediate energy and
kinematics of possible experiments with HADES, CLAS and KEK-PS
